So here's the deal. Whenever I connect my Zune to my computer, all it does is charge it and open the Zune software. The problem is, neither my Zune nor my home computer know they're connected. The software says it's not connected, but then how is it charging?
And I've tried switching USB ports, reinstalling the software, AND reseting my Zune.
